Acceptable Use Policies (AUPs) are vital for outlining acceptable technology usage in organizations. Common policy statements include prohibited activities, data privacy and security, monitoring, intellectual property rights, and consequences of violations. Understanding these statements helps protect users and organizations from misuse and legal issues. ;
